The Refuge for DMST is a small nonprofit organization that operates a long-term, residential program called The Refuge Ranch for girls up to 19 years old who have been rescued from sex trafficking. The ranch sits on 50 acres just outside Austin, Texas, and offers trauma-informed, holistic care on site. On campus, psychiatric services come through Dell Medical School at the University of Texas at Austin, education is provided by the UT-University Charter School, medical services are delivered by community partners, and a range of therapeutic programs supports the development of child survivors. The organization is based in the Austin area and operates within the nonprofit sector, targeting a vulnerable youth population. It is described as the largest long-term, live-in rehabilitation facility for child survivors of sex trafficking in the United States. The organization maintains a small staff to coordinate on-site care, education, and related services for residents.
